Transaction 8c8fc48524a182865c0662a7ee2af744d4ccff658da85176cbc77eac6a0081d3
1 Input
1 Output
-
8c8fc48524a182865c0662a7ee2af744d4ccff658da85176cbc77eac6a0081d3:0
- value
- 8059146
- script pubkey
- OP_0 OP_PUSHBYTES_32 b68fd515d7906522b87f6ad1a51b7671642456772b9272ad05a5cf1822c6a177
- address
- bc1qk68a29whjpjj9wrldtg62xmkw9jzg4nh9wf89tg95h83sgkx59ms6fynhu